What you would have had to done, first thing this morning (or last night) is go to the UPS website where you put in your tracking number. Beneath it would have been an option to divert the delivery to another location for pickup.

Up until 6 months ago, you could have it ready to be be picked up at the local UPS store. We have a processing plant in our area where I would go pick it up.

Now they charge you $5 to do it.

The pickup would be at 9am when UPS opens. That also means having to get to the location early as most certainly, you are standing on line with a dozen other Apple geeks waiting to pick their device up as well.
